How do you use online banking?

Begin online banking with a few steps

  1. Gather your account numbers. Your account numbers should be on your paper statement.
  2. Find your bank or credit union’s website.
  3. Register for access to your bank or credit union’s online banking platform.
  4. Log in and take a tutorial.

How do I log into my bank account online?

Open your web browser on your computer and visit your bank’s website. Select “online banking.” Browse the homepage of your bank’s website and click on the link that says “online banking.” If you don’t see the words “online banking” specifically, just look for the button that says “login.” Register for an account.

Is debit card necessary for mobile banking?

The requirement of debit card details to register to net banking was made mandatory for the sole purpose of security and to curb false transactions. The users who do not have debit card/ATM card details, have to visit their bank branch to complete the process of registration for net banking.

Why can’t I get into my online banking?

Please ensure you are using an up to date and fully supported browser to use Online Banking. Make sure you have cleared temporary internet files and cookies and your browser has extensions and add-ons disabled. If needed, also try restarting your device and router, and try a wired connection.

What is a good password example?

An example of a strong password is “Cartoon-Duck-14-Coffee-Glvs”. It is long, contains uppercase letters, l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ters. It is a unique password created by a random password generator and it is easy to remember. Strong passwords should not contain personal information.

Is online banking dangerous?

Due to the open nature of the Internet, all web-based services such as YAB’s Online Banking are inherently subject to risks such as online theft of your User ID/UserName, Password, virus attacks, hacking, unauthorized access and fraudulent transactions.
